    CHARLI EVANS vs BEANO for the GOOD Wrestling Grand Prize

    After the Gift of GOOD tournament at GOODSTOCK, eventual tournament winner Mike Bird put over the efforts of finalist CHARLI EVANS, Charli having gotten so close to the guaranteed title shot at any time, was gifted a shot against BEANO, the man from the NP44 has not lost a singles match in GOOD Wrestling since debuting, and has shown time and time again why he deserves to hold the Grand Prize but he now faces one of his toughest challenges to date...

    AVERAGEgenebrookes.jpg

    EUGENE MUNN vs CHRIS BROOKES

    GOODSTOCK saw the attempted retirement of EUGENE MUNN (fka GENE MUNNY), the man who helped build GOOD Wrestling doesn't want anything to do with us since he lost his Certificate of Excellence and no longer boasts that he is the God of GOOD or Big King Dick... We however realise that Gene is a corner stone of GOOD Wrestling and really want to see the Sexual Gammon return in all his glory... What better way than bringing back his old buddy and pal CHRIS BROOKES to temp him out of "retirement"!?

    AVERAGEchapmanbailey.jpg

    KURTIS CHAPMAN vs SPEEDBALL MIKE BAILEY

    GOOD Wrestling has seen its fair share of young up and comers since debuting in 2016... Very few have had the raw talent that comes with KURTIS CHAPMAN, he made his debut at GOODSTOCK and impressed in both matches, impressed so much that when Mike Bird had to pull out of his return encounter with SPEEDBALL MIKE BAILEY, Bailey himself asked for the super contender to step in the ring with him! Probably so he can just cave Chappers chest in with his bare feet.

    AVERAGEbankscupid.jpg

    WARREN BANKS vs KING CUPID

    For months, the GOOD Wrestling faithful had been wondering who "The King" was - At GOODSTOCK we found out, when KING CUPID with his man servent JOSHWA debuted... However their appearance was not without controversy, during the Survivo Series pick'em, Cupid turned on his team mate WARREN BANKS, leading to Banks elimination, Banks has called out Cupid to right his wrong, and frankly, there's probably going to be a murder.

  5. My parents didn't particularly like our love of wrestling so it was when I started getting in to the independent and international wrestling as an adult I went to NOAH's European Navigation in Coventry in 2008.

     

    Mark Haskins, El Ligero, Zack Sabre Jr, Dave Mastiff, Doug Williams, Joel Redman, Nigel McGuiness, Bryan Danielson, Eddie Edwards & Jay Briscoes being the Gaijin on the card.

     

    Yone, Morishima, Kenta, Akiyama and the headliner of Shiozaki, Kobashi, Misawa & Marifuji.

     

    Amazing show. I have it on DVD somewhere, may get it out.

     

    The next shows I went too were a Raw and Smackdown taping in April 2012 (the one where Jericho said Punk was drinking in a pub). Then I've been to something pretty much every month since.
